Considerations To Know About what is md5 technology
Considerations To Know About what is md5 technology
Blog Article
For these so-identified as collision attacks to operate, an attacker should be able to govern two individual inputs while in the hope of at some point finding two separate combinations which have a matching hash.
The main reason for this is this modulo Procedure can only give us ten separate results, and with ten random figures, there is nothing halting a few of These results from currently being the same selection.
Diagram displaying utilization of MD5 hashing in file transmission Mainly because it is easy to crank out MD5 collisions, it can be done for the person who established the file to produce a 2nd file Together with the similar checksum, so this technique cannot guard in opposition to some types of destructive tampering.
The MD5 algorithm analyses incoming facts and produces a set-dimensions hash benefit. Now that we’ve mentioned what is MD5 hash, Permit’s evaluate how does MD5 operates:
Collision Assault Vulnerability: MD5 is vulnerable to collision attacks. Collision occurs when two different inputs make the exact same hash price. Researchers have confirmed practical collision attacks on MD5, which means attackers can purposefully deliver assorted inputs leading to the identical MD5 hash output. The integrity and security of programmes jeopardise hash capabilities for knowledge identification.
This higher sensitivity to adjustments causes it to be exceptional for knowledge integrity checks. If even one pixel of a picture is altered, the MD5 hash will transform, alerting you into the modification.
This is why, often, It really is improved to maneuver on to far more contemporary and safe solutions. But hey, we'll look at Those people in the subsequent segment.
At the end of these 4 rounds, the output from Just about every block is blended to make the ultimate MD5 hash. This hash would be the 128-bit benefit we discussed before.
Development infrastructure management goods speed some time and lessen the hard get more info work necessary to handle your community, purposes and fundamental infrastructure.
MD5 is effective by way of a series of effectively-defined steps that contain breaking down the enter facts into manageable chunks, processing these chunks, and combining the results to make a ultimate 128-little bit hash price. Here is an in depth rationalization in the techniques involved with the MD5 algorithm.
This is critically crucial for cybersecurity mainly because this one of a kind hash is practically unduplicated, which in turn will make that exceptional hash a protected reference to the particular knowledge established.
e. path may possibly transform consistently and traffic is dynamic. So, static TOT cannot be utilized at TCP. And unnecessarily retransmitting the identical knowledge packet a number of periods may perhaps cause congestion. Answer for this i
A collision is when two distinctive inputs end in the exact same hash. Collision resistance is unbelievably critical for any cryptographic hash perform to remain secure. A collision-resistant hash function is built in such a way that it's unfeasible for that hash of 1 input to get similar to the hash of a special input.
The DevX Technology Glossary is reviewed by technology industry experts and writers from our Local community. Phrases and definitions keep on to go underneath updates to stay related and up-to-day.